Grupo SURA marks 15 years in the S&P Global Sustainability Yearbook

  • Grupo SURA was once again included in the S&P Global Sustainability Yearbook 2026, standing out among 9,200 companies evaluated worldwide.
  • The Company obtained a score of 71 out of a total of 100 in the 2025 Corporate Sustainability Assessment, making it one of just 33 companies from the global financial service sector for its level of performance in these aspects.
  • This recognition consolidates 15 years of leadership in sustainability, backed by the progress made in ethics, corporate governance, talent management and sustainable finance.

Grupo SURA was included in the S&P Sustainability Yearbook 2026, a S&P Global publication that highlights companies with the best performance in corporate sustainability on a global level. This only goes to reaffirm the Company's commitment to responsible management, sustainable value creation and transparency towards its stakeholders.

"Our vision of sustainability is a central part of Grupo SURA's strategy as a criterion for decision making. Having been admitted yet again in the 2026 Yearbook reflects our ongoing effort to understand our performance in terms of international standards, thereby allowing us to continue realizing the value that results from a  proper management of environmental, social, and governance issues, both for the company from the risk management standpoint as well as for society as a whole," stated Lina Uribe, Grupo SURA´s Director of Sustainability .

For this year´s edition, S&P Global evaluated more than 9,200 companies worldwide, of which only 848 managed to be selected as members of the 2026 Yearbook, thereby forming a group of high performers in terms of environmental, social and governance (ESG) issues. In the case of the Diverse Financial Service and Capital Markets sector, the category in which Grupo SURA is classified, 418 companies were evaluated and only 33 were included in this publication, six of which are from Latin America.

Our inclusion is based on the results of the Corporate Sustainability Assessment (CSA) 2025, where Grupo SURA obtained a score of 71 out of a total of 100. This rating reflects our strengths particularly in risk management, business ethics, sustainable finance and human talent management.
